A CHAT WITH @modprobe

SteemMag:
What was it like working on graphene? and what was your reaction when you discovered Steemit was going to be built on it?

@modprobe:
Working on Graphene was fun. The idea for Graphene came after the launch of the Bitshares 0.x series, which was based on a code-base that had evolved for several years and no longer had any consistent style or organization.
It had to be scrapped and replaced, and we decided to make the new version as flexible as possible -- rather than just make Bitshares 2, we would make a generalized blockchain framework which would serve as a starting point for any new blockchain, providing all of the standard blockchain functionality and allowing developers to immediately get started on the unique parts of their idea.

I think Steem is a testament to our success: the idea for Steem didn't come until well after Graphene was finished, yet going from Graphene to a public release of Steem took just a few months, which is an impressive development pace for a brand new blockchain.

How has been your experience so far on Steemit and what improvements would you like to see?

@modprobe:
So far, Steemit has been a good experience. It's been fun to watch the UI evolve to support more of the chain's features. I'm not sure there's any improvements to the chain itself that I see as being critically important just now... I look forward to seeing more apps start up around the Steem ecosystem.

Currently, everyone builds 3rd party blockchain apps on Bitcoin because it has the network effect, and a little on Ethereum because it has the marketing, but Steem is the only chain that lets people do things for free, and that opens up a whole new world of possibility. For instance, I'm really looking forward to some decentralized marketplaces on Steem, and I think Steem could outperform Ethereum in the turing-complete smart contract
market too, when someone takes on the task of building the infrastructure for it.
